Claims
- 1. An automatic transmission for a vehicle having gearing defining multiple torque flow paths between a throttle controlled engine and a torque output shaft comprising a first gear unit with at least three forward-driving ratios and a second gear unit with at least two forward driving ratios, said gear units being disposed in series relationship in said torque flow paths, said torque flow paths including a torque converter with an impeller driven by said engine and a turbine connected drivably to said second gear unit;
- pressure-operated clutch and brake means for establishing and disestablishing ratio changes in said gearing including a first reaction brake means for anchoring a reaction element of said first gear unit during operation in an intermediate ratio of said first gear unit and a second reaction brake means for anchoring a reaction element of said second gear unit during operation in the higher of said two forward driving ratios of said second gear unit;
- said first reaction brake means including a first brake servo having a first servo piston and brake release and apply pressure chambers on opposite sides of said first servo piston;
- said second reaction brake means including a second brake servo having a second servo piston and brake apply pressure and release chambers on opposite sides of said second brake servo piston;
- two independent solenoid operated regulator valve means for establishing separate brake servo actuating pressures for said first and second brake servos;
- a control valve system for controlling distribution of pressure to said brake means including said apply pressure chambers for said first and second brake servo pressure chamber, said valve system including a source of line pressure and a pressure regulator valve means for regulating said line pressure;
- said independent solenoid operated regulator valve means being in fluid communication with said control valve system and said pressure regulator valve means;
- said control valve system including shift valve means for selectively and separately distributing said servo actuating pressures to said apply pressure chambers whereby brake capacities during application and release of said first and second reaction brake means are controlled independently, one with respect to the other, to effect smooth transition of reaction torque from one of said gear units to the other during upshifts and downshifts.
